The missing page in Chapter 140
The kraft paper bag was opened in that empty office upstairs.
There were only four people in the room: Ye Feng, Lin Yuqing, Zhu Wanqing, and Shen Yu. The bag contained only three things: a photograph, a photocopy, and a handwritten note.
The photo is black and white with yellowed edges, clearly quite old. It shows seven or eight people standing in front of an old-fashioned building, all wearing woolen overcoats in the style of the 1990s.
Lin Yuqing's finger landed on the woman in the very center.
"This is my mom."
The woman was young, her hair was pulled back, she was holding a baby in her arms, and she was smiling, her eyes curving into an arc.
"This is me." Lin Yuqing touched the baby with her fingertips, very lightly, as if afraid of hurting him.
Zhu Wanqing reached out and put her hand on her shoulder.
"Look here." Ye Feng's finger landed on the far left of the photo.
There was a man standing there.
He wasn't young anymore, around fifty, wearing a faded old Zhongshan suit, thin and standing ramrod straight. He wasn't looking at the camera, but tilting his head, gazing at something outside the frame of the photo.
Shen Yu let out an "Ah!" and plopped back down in his chair.
"master."
The room fell silent; no one spoke first. Ye Feng stared at the photograph, remaining silent for a long time. In the lower right corner of the photograph was the date: Winter, 2000.
Twenty-six years ago. Lin Yuqing was still an infant then. Ye Feng hadn't even been born yet. His master carried him from the mass grave to Nirvana Mountain twenty years after this photograph.
His master was standing next to this woman.
"Where did this photo come from?" Zhu Wanqing asked in a hoarse voice.
Ye Feng picked up the photocopy.
It was a photocopy of a police file, addressed to "Criminal Investigation Detachment of Dongyang Public Security Bureau," and dated 2005—the year Mrs. Zhao died of a "sudden illness."
On the photocopy, one page number is skipped. After page seventeen, it jumps directly to page nineteen. Page eighteen is missing.
On Old Zhou's note, only two lines were written:
"The eighteenth page is the visit record. There was one person visited, but the name column was crossed out, leaving only the place of origin: Niepanshan Tingxue Town."
"The photos came from the safe in your uncle's study. He kept them for twenty-six years."
Ye Feng clenched his fists.
"My master," he said, emphasizing each word, "recognizes your mother."
"I not only recognize him." Lin Yuqing's voice trembled. "Twenty-six years ago, he stood at my door and hugged me. He was there. In 2005, when my mother had her accident, the police interviewed him. Then, that page was torn out."
Zhu Wanqing looked at the note over and over again, her brows furrowing more and more deeply.
"Let me interject," she said. "There's something wrong with this."
"you say."
"Old Zhou said the photos were taken from the safe in Lin Guodong's study, and he kept them for twenty-six years." Zhu Wanqing looked up. "Yuqing, we've all figured out what kind of person your uncle is in the last six months. He's greedy, he's cowardly, and he's good at keeping small accounts."
"Would someone like that, holding a photograph that could unravel a long-standing case involving a wealthy family, keep it hidden for twenty-six years?"
Lin Yuqing's expression changed slightly.
"Unless he dares not touch it," Zhu Wanqing said, emphasizing each word. "Unless he already knew that what was behind this photo was something he couldn't afford to offend. So he dared not sell it, dared not burn it, and dared not hand it over. He could only lock it up."
"There's one more thing." Zhu Wanqing pulled out the photocopy again. "The missing eighteenth page is the interview record. The interview record was handwritten by the criminal police, in duplicate, one for filing and one for record-keeping. The one for filing was taken."
"What about the copy we kept as a backup?"
Shen Yu suddenly stood up and paced back and forth in the room twice.
"This doesn't make sense!" he cried, his voice hoarse. "Master hasn't left the mountain in the past twenty years! He rarely even goes to Tingxue Town!"
"He did it," Ye Feng said.
"What?"
"Thirty-four years ago, he spent forty days brewing medicine in the south," Ye Feng counted on his fingers. "Twenty-six years ago, he was in this photo. Twenty years ago, he went to Dongyang and was questioned by the police. Then he returned to the mountains and stayed there for twenty years, never to come out again."
He looked up at the three people in the room.
There's one sentence in my master's letter that I've never understood.
He said, "The ordeal she suffered was much earlier than yours."
"I used to think that 'early' meant that the event happened a long time ago."
"I understand now."
Ye Feng gently placed the photo on the table.
"'Early' means: He knew it much earlier than I did."
"Twenty-six years earlier."
"He was already waiting at their doorstep before she was even born."
Inside the room, no one spoke. Lin Yuqing reached out, picked up the photograph, and looked at it again. Her gaze slowly shifted from her mother's face to the man in the worn-out Zhongshan suit.
"Ye Feng".
"Um."
"Your master's words, 'I didn't dare leave my other half in someone else's hands; I returned it,'"
She looked up.
"We always thought that 'returning it back' meant returning Nirvana Mountain."
"But he held me in his arms twenty-six years ago."
"He was questioned by the police about my mother's case twenty years ago."
"His life was intertwined with Nirvana Mountain, and also with our family."
She placed the photo face down on the table, her voice soft, yet each word was as sharp as iron:
"Could the place we're 'returning' be somewhere other than that mountain?"
"Could it be—"
"Where is my mom?"
Ye Feng's breath caught in his throat. Outside the window, the night in Dongyang was brightly lit. Standing amidst this sea of lights, he suddenly recalled that night in the Hidden Vein Hall, and the last three words in his master's letter.
Protect her.
He had always taken those three words as a promise. Only now did he realize—it wasn't a promise. It was the words of a man who had guarded the line for twenty-six years, as he handed over the last thread in his hand.
"Senior Brother Shen," Ye Feng finally spoke.
"exist."
"Book the earliest car."
"Go back where?"
Ye Feng put the photo into his pocket.
"Back to Tingxue Town."
"My master is there, and there must be another place that none of us know about."
Zhu Wanqing put the copy into the file bag and stood up.
"I'll check the copy on file," she said. "I have connections in the city bureau's old warehouse. It should only take three days."
"Aren't you going into the mountains?"
"I can't fight, what would I do in the mountains?" She tucked the folder under her arm, walked to the door, and said, "I'll stay here and watch the house."
The door closed. Lin Yuqing stood by the window, gazing at the passing car lights below, silent for a long time. Ye Feng walked to her side.
"What are you thinking about?"
"I miss my mom," she said. "I'm twenty-six this year. She was two years younger than I am now when she died. In that photo, she's holding me, smiling so happily. Standing next to her is an old man I've never met. That old man later raised you in the mountains."
She turned her head.
"Ye Feng, do you think there's any such coincidence in this world?"
Ye Feng did not answer.
He recalled his master's words in the letter: "You have to cultivate this destiny yourself."
At that time, he only thought it was the old man's good intentions.
"Yuqing".
"Um?"
"There's no such thing as a coincidence in this world."
